Transaction

8cefc9d33858a91bee07f80b4d11e7a77292e9dc4ebe0d750db7e2005efbbe67
271,430 confirmations
Timestamp
1611064416
Block666,757
Fee16,241 sats
Fee rate75.2 sats/vB
view on mempool.space

Inputs & Outputs